Nikkei rises as trading firms gain; Toshiba up

TOKYO | Mon Nov 9, 2009 7:14pm EST

TOKYO Nov 10 (Reuters) - Japan's Nikkei stock average rose 0.9 percent on Tuesday, buoyed by a broad range of shares after Wall Street climbed, with Mitsubishi Corp (8058.T) and other trading firms up on higher commodities prices. Toshiba Corp (6502.T) rose more than 2 percent after it made an offer for French nuclear reactor builder Areva's CEPFi.PA power transmission and distribution business in a consortium with investment fund Innovation Network Corp of Japan. The benchmark Nikkei .N225 gained 88.84 points to 9,897.83, while the broader Topix .TOPX rose 0.7 percent to 876.65. (Reporting by Elaine Lies)
